Obrázek může být reprezentace.
Viz Specifikace pro podrobnosti o produktu.
PIC16C77-20I/PT

PIC16C77-20I/PT

Introduction

The PIC16C77-20I/PT is a microcontroller belonging to the PIC16C series, which is widely used in various electronic applications. This entry provides an overview of the product, including its category, use, characteristics, package, essence, packaging/quantity, specifications, detailed pin configuration, functional features, advantages and disadvantages, working principles, detailed application field plans, and alternative models.

Basic Information Overview

  • Category: Microcontroller
  • Use: Embedded control applications
  • Characteristics: Low power consumption, high performance, versatile I/O capabilities
  • Package: 44-pin TQFP (Thin Quad Flat Package)
  • Essence: Integration of CPU, memory, and I/O peripherals on a single chip
  • Packaging/Quantity: Tape and reel, quantity varies based on supplier

Specifications

  • Operating Voltage: 2.5V to 6.0V
  • Clock Speed: 20 MHz
  • Program Memory Size: 8 KB
  • RAM Size: 368 bytes
  • I/O Pins: 33
  • Timers: 3
  • Analog-to-Digital Converters (ADC): 8 channels, 10-bit resolution
  • Communication Interfaces: USART, SPI, I2C

Detailed Pin Configuration

The PIC16C77-20I/PT features a 44-pin TQFP package with specific pin assignments for power, ground, I/O, and communication interfaces. The detailed pin configuration can be found in the product datasheet.

Functional Features

  • Integrated Peripherals: Includes timers, ADC, communication interfaces, and other essential peripherals for embedded control applications.
  • Low Power Consumption: Optimized architecture for efficient power management.
  • Versatile I/O Capabilities: Supports a wide range of input and output configurations for interfacing with external devices.

Advantages and Disadvantages

Advantages

  • High performance
  • Low power consumption
  • Versatile I/O capabilities

Disadvantages

  • Limited program memory size
  • Restricted RAM capacity

Working Principles

The PIC16C77-20I/PT operates based on the Harvard architecture, featuring separate program and data memory spaces. It executes instructions fetched from program memory and interacts with external devices through its I/O peripherals.

Detailed Application Field Plans

The PIC16C77-20I/PT is suitable for various embedded control applications, including but not limited to: - Industrial automation - Consumer electronics - Automotive systems - Medical devices

Detailed and Complete Alternative Models

  • PIC16F877A
  • PIC18F4520
  • ATmega328P

In summary, the PIC16C77-20I/PT is a versatile microcontroller with a range of features suitable for diverse embedded control applications. Its low power consumption, high performance, and versatile I/O capabilities make it a popular choice among developers. However, its limited program memory size and restricted RAM capacity should be considered when selecting this microcontroller for specific applications.

Word count: 433

Seznam 10 běžných otázek a odpovědí souvisejících s aplikací PIC16C77-20I/PT v technických řešeních

  1. What is the operating voltage range of PIC16C77-20I/PT?
    - The operating voltage range of PIC16C77-20I/PT is 2.0V to 5.5V.

  2. What are the key features of PIC16C77-20I/PT?
    - Some key features of PIC16C77-20I/PT include 8-bit microcontroller, 20 MHz speed, and 8K x 14 words of Flash Program Memory.

  3. Can PIC16C77-20I/PT be used in automotive applications?
    - Yes, PIC16C77-20I/PT can be used in automotive applications due to its wide operating voltage range and robust design.

  4. What communication interfaces does PIC16C77-20I/PT support?
    - PIC16C77-20I/PT supports USART, SPI, and I2C communication interfaces.

  5. Is PIC16C77-20I/PT suitable for battery-powered devices?
    - Yes, PIC16C77-20I/PT is suitable for battery-powered devices due to its low power consumption and wide operating voltage range.

  6. Can PIC16C77-20I/PT be used in industrial control systems?
    - Yes, PIC16C77-20I/PT can be used in industrial control systems due to its high-speed operation and robust design.

  7. What development tools are available for programming PIC16C77-20I/PT?
    - Development tools such as MPLAB X IDE and PICkit programmers are available for programming PIC16C77-20I/PT.

  8. Does PIC16C77-20I/PT have built-in analog-to-digital converters (ADC)?
    - Yes, PIC16C77-20I/PT has built-in 10-bit ADC modules for analog signal processing.

  9. Can PIC16C77-20I/PT be used in temperature-sensitive applications?
    - Yes, PIC16C77-20I/PT can be used in temperature-sensitive applications with proper thermal management.

  10. What are the available package options for PIC16C77-20I/PT?
    - PIC16C77-20I/PT is available in various package options including PDIP, SOIC, and TQFP.